Okay so I'm giving @corseque 's super-important audio of all Solas' comments about the Blight a second (or fifteenth, whatever) listen and taking notes as I go.
Solas doesn't think for a second that once the archdemons are gone the Blight will be gone. Which really makes sense because it's the Blight that makes them an archdemon, not the other way around. Supposedly, they're blighted when the darkspawn reach and corrupt them. But of course that begs the question of why it's only darkspawn (and uh, honorary darkspawn like the Wardens) that hear their call. Anyway, the way he says it, it sounds more like the archdemons are a limiting factor than a driving factor.
Varric: "What's so confusing about endless darkspawn?" Solas: "A great deal!" So yeah, whatever the plan was, he didn't foresee darkspawn as a consequence. So did he not foresee them existing at all, or not foresee them being free to cause problems? Worth noting that it's really clear both in general and in Descent that dwarves as a whole were a huge blind spot for him.
He is really really surprised that the Western Approach ever recovered from the Blight. Pretty clear he didn't think that was possible.
He thinks that everything the Wardens have done up til now is a deeply misguided effort that's served (mostly accidentally) as a delaying tactic. Gotta say, with the information we have at hand, this point pairs about as well with the last as a nice dry red with spicy pickles. If the Wardens shouldn't have done what they've done, but he didn't think recovery from the Blight was possible, I'd love to hear what he thought the alternative was.
Same dialogue as above, but when Solas talks about stopping the Blight and when Blackwall and Varric talk about it, one gets the distinct impression that they're talking at cross purposes, because Varric and Blackwall are talking about the experience of Blights, as in, periodic events, whereas I think Solas is talking about THE Blight, that is, its true nature, which is yet untouched.
He thinks Erimond is dumb as shit, which is fair and valid. "That's madness! For all we know, killing the Old Gods could make things even worse!" he says. Well, he knows a lot more than "we" know, but it's entirely possible that he doesn't for sure know this. Increasingly clear that he thinks it, though.
I'd forgotten just how pissed off he was about the Grey Warden plan to kill the Old Gods before they were corrupted. It really doesn't give "hey you're killing my relatives" energy. It really gives "wow that would fuck us all" vibes.
Of course, with a side of my remembering that Solas' besetting flaw was always thinking people should know better even though they don't have access to the knowledge he has. That flaw I WILL grant. He displays it repeatedly--you could even say the writers went out of their way to make the point.
"The Blight is the real problem"
"The fools who first unleashed the Blight on this world thought they were unlocking ultimate power." Anyway yeah those are the absolute core of everything here. The Blight is the real problem and the Blight was deliberate. Deliberately made or deliberately freed.
Even during the events of Inquisition, Solas obviously sees Corypheus as secondary to the Blight as a danger.
Cassandra suggests that the archdemons were really just dragons--"Pets to those who no longer exist", by which she probably means the Old Gods, not specifically the gods of Elvhen, just because of her cultural background. Solas finds this suggestion amusingly wrong--a quiet snort, and "I would not go so far as that."
Last notes: he doesn't sound like he thinks the Blight can be stopped, and he's adamant that it can't be controlled. Which is presumably why he broke the world in an attempt to contain it, assuming I'm right that that was the underlying reason for the Veil. That it didn't quite work the way he'd hoped is also pretty evident, though I wanna be clear that I assume he was working from a place of desperation, and that not knowing every possible outcome of an action is not a condemnation of having taken it.

Thereā€™s Only One Winner For Isengard
In a perfect world, in a world with no meta requirements that could bend to the will of the player, we would roll up to Isengard level-capped, no debuffs, with one quest-marker on hand: Ruin Sarumanā€™s day. But this is a pre-written sequence of events in which we are only along for the ride. We, the player, and a Ranger are shipped off to Isengard with only one conceivable goal: survive. On a meta level we know what Saruman is capable of. At level 70 or 80-something at best, even we are aware that we are no match for a wizard with a canon fate. Not to mention our Ranger companion! The Grey Company has been through enough (though we donā€™t know the half of it yet) and we are reasonably distraught at the possibilities.
This is why we, the player character, will lose the game of Isengard.
Beyond the meta rules of the game, where quest objectives are whatever the devs wanted them to be (looking at you, Mordrambor) the player character can not defeat Saruman in any way thatā€™s meaningful. And (again on a meta level) in order for us to get to experience the action at Helmā€™s Deep and Rohan at large, we have to get out of Isengard. Weā€™d get bored of waiting for Theoden and Co. Weā€™d hurl insults or slap fish at Saruman and realistically incur wrath. Honestly, with the set of circumstances presented to us, who could survive imprisonment in Nan Curunir?
Only one of the Company ever could: Lothrandir of Suri Kyla.Ā 
To begin with, none of the Rangers we have any real information on could have done it. Anyone whoā€™s spent time in Angmar is at a disadvantage due to the prevailing dread (game mechanic or otherwise) that can be manipulated by Saruman. Any Ranger that has a major traumatic past is at a disadvantage (sorry Mincham) because if nothing else, Saruman has proven to be a master of illusion. Even Halbarad for all his leadership ability has a pretty exploitable weakness: eventually Saruman can crack the code with a vision of Aragornā€™s demise, the one end Halbarad must fear above all others. Or what bond could more easily be exploited than that of a leader and his men? Lheu Breninā€™s in the gang now after all. All Saruman would have to do was send for a few more incentives.Ā 
But Lothrandir comes built with a few key advantages that make him the only Grey Company Ranger qualified to come out of this battle of wills on top. His specific strengths, mindset, and personality traits combined with the circumstances that the game sets up going into Isengard make him the clear choice of Rangers- if a Ranger you must have- to stay behind in Nan Curunir.Ā 
Lothrandir wins because he changes the game. From ā€˜goā€™ our co-prisoner does something that either puzzles the player character or sends them into an anxious fit. Lothrandir declares himself fearless and sprints recklessly into the ring. Any way you figure it, this seems like a poorly calculated move. He doesnā€™t stop to survey the enemy. He doesnā€™t gather intel. Heck, he doesnā€™t even bide his time to see if heā€™ll be killed before he even reaches the dungeons. Lothrandir sprints right in without so much as a thought or a plan. Saruman doesnā€™t know it yet, but from that moment on Lothrandir has him on the back foot.Ā 
Consider for a moment Sarumanā€™s MO. Heā€™s a wizard, and he uses a great deal of magic, sure, but time and time again we are reminded of the power of his voice and his words. He calls down a storm on Caradhras (in the movies for darn sure), he via-Wormtongue whispers poison into the ears of King Theoden. He doesnā€™t lead with any kind of grandiose display when trying to sway Gandalf. No, he leads with a persuasive argument. Later on, he nearly talks Theoden back around, after failing to wipe out all of Rohan. After killing the manā€™s son for goodness sakes. He nearly talks himself out of that one!
But Lothrandir has already changed this from a game of wits to a game of wills. There will be no vying for favor, or biding time, or compliance, or even giving Saruman a chance to ā€˜talk it over friendlyā€™ first. Heā€™s already spitting on the shoes of everyone he sees. The accomplishment in this is twofold, and it makes a major impact on the rest of his time in Nan Curunir.Ā 
Firstly, by establishing a new game, Lothrandir sets Saruman up for a whole lot of assumptions. He does not display any signs of diplomatic ability, wisdom, or even common sense. He very intentionally projects an attitude of reckless disobedience. In the playerā€™s own eyes, it seems as if he ā€˜doesnā€™t know any betterā€™. This gives Saruman a clear path to take regarding Lothrandir. He assumes you canā€™t reason the typical way with someone who has shown zero inclination for listening. The player character demonstrates that the Grey Company (or least their associates) are capable of compliance. For all intents and purposes, this Lothrandir doesnā€™t appear to be. Heā€™s contrary, fool-hardy, and evidently dumb enough to dive in headfirst and get himself killed. You beat that kind of guy into submissionā€¦ donā€™t you?
But Lothrandir has changed the rules of the game. Saruman is no longer fighting with his best weapon, but with a tool to be found in any old villainā€™s arsenal. When he took the approach of reasoning with the player character and disregarding Lothrandir, he set the victorā€™s foundation on our snow-pilgrimā€™s greatest strength.Ā 
Secondly, by establishing a new game, Lothrandir makes this a battle of physical endurance. Unbeknownst to Saruman, this is the one thing that makes him stand out from the rest of the Grey Company. He has walked through the frozen north lands and the fiery south lands and come out unscathed. He has mastered the unarmed combat style of the Lossoth by joining in mid-winter wrestling matches in a place that took down many Elves, Angmarim, and notably one King of Arthedain! Lothrandir has conceivably spent his entire life training for this matchup. Any endurance he has built up, any fighting he can do without access to a weapon, all are assets to the kind of game he just made Saruman play. Lothrandir is uniquely built to survive any physical torment Isengard can throw at him, or at least, better equipped than any of the others.Ā 
To say Lothrandir is the best choice, we also have to rule out the others. Corunir was thwarted by the Rammas Deluon and for all he learned from that, itā€™s a weak spot in his proverbial armor. Golodir too, resisted a fair degree of torture (palantiri based, even!) in Carn Dum, but it wonā€™t be hard for Saruman to suss that one out and make our old manā€™s life a living nightmare. Even Radanir, serious and seemingly unattached to any social bonds now that his good pal Elweleth has gone sailing, would be a poor choice. He is too serious, (for lack of a better term) too genre-savvy, and even if he is spitting blood and delivering a witty one-liner, thatā€™s Sarumanā€™s foot in the door! ā€˜Iā€™ll never betray my friends and kin, you kaleidoscope hackā€™? Youā€™ve just told him your weakness, Radanir! No, he canā€™t keep his mouth shut to save his (or Saerdanā€™s) life. Radanir is the wrong choice too.
We donā€™t know a significant amount about the others (except Ranger death would move Calenglad to tears, we canā€™t put him through this) in order to pinpoint their fatal flaws in the Isengard encounter. But, the game puts us in the incredible position of having seen Lothrandirā€™s Achillesā€™ heel and letting us take that disadvantage away.Ā 
Lothrandir of Suri Kyla is uniquely equipped to survive any physical encounter that Saruman throws his way. Now, whoā€™s to say the wizard wonā€™t change his tune and go back to his old tricks? In an incredible twist of fate, we are. The game sets us, the player, up to play Sarumanā€™s game from the get-go. We keep our pixelated head down, try and fly below the radar, and express just enough concern over the fate of our fool-hardy pal to get Saruman to cement his estimation of Lothrandir as a pawn in the game in stone. By making ourselves the better target for the words of a wily wizard, Saruman decides that the best way to deal with the spare prisoner is by playing right into his hands. As we all know, the player character escapes. While that might seem bad for someone who Saruman has earmarked for corporal punishment only, it covers Lothrandirā€™s one weakness.Ā 
Aside from being the only significant unarmed fighter, Lothrandir is also never painted as a loner. He spends his time in Suri Kyla, hanging out with the Lossoth and sharing their campfires. In the new questline in Forochel, he jumps at the chance to make a new Dunedain friend and takes to King Arvedui like a duck to water. Theyā€™re instant best pals. Itā€™s minutes before Lothrandir is telling him Aragornā€™s life story and pledging to go with him on a buddy adventure to seek peace for a regretful shade. And if thatā€™s not enough canon for you, Lothrandir bears the brunt of the Falcon clan aggression on the way to Isengard. He does it for you, his friend and companion in suffering. Itā€™s a bit meta, but we have to assume in the internal universe he knows you a little. Youā€™ve run your merry adventures to a degree where, were this not a video game, Lothrandir would at least consider you an ally if not a friend outright.Ā 
He exposes his weakness unwittingly to the Falcon clan, but he leaves it at the gates of Isengard in an extremely well-timed move. By sprinting through the gates without a care as to whatā€™s going on with you or anyone else, Lothrandir establishes an emotional distance between you both in the eyes of any onlookers. Whatever affection you have for him, it doesnā€™t seem reciprocated. This isnā€™t a major weakness for Saruman to exploit, then. Youā€™re not one of his kinsmen. If he did want to pursue that line, he could always send to Tur Morva for one, right?
This is where the game comes back in to shift the tide in Lothrandirā€™s favor. We escape. We play the game, we nearly lose the game, and had we not been given an out the power scaling makes it difficult to conceive of an outcome where we the player can win Isengard. Sure, weā€™ve been released from prisons before (Delossad to name one) but this is the climax of Dunland. We make a daring escape, and move south towards the Gap of Rohan and all sorts of bad times.Ā 
Back in Nan Curunir, Lothrandir is getting the daylights beat out of him, and taking a victory lap. Heā€™s cemented his position as ā€˜the prisoner weā€™ll break with violenceā€™. The uruks have seen him insubordinate and disorderly. In the Lothrandir interlude, thereā€™s not only the canon (stated outright!) reality of past and present torture. Thereā€™s also zero hesitation in Lothrandir taking that one on the chin. There are no other objectives on his mind than making the next few minutes as miserable as possible for everyone around. He has no other goals. And he doesnā€™t need them. Nobody is surprised that Lothrandir is signing his death warrant within nanoseconds of being presented an offer to comply. He spits on the offer. He tips over the slop bucket. He beats bloody any orc (and gameplay purposes aside there are very few that dare come forward) that actually tries to kill him for it outright.Ā 
Heā€™s built up a non-rapport with Gun Ain. She talks about killing him and he doesnā€™t say anything. Theyā€™re all playing his game and heā€™s winning. In the conversation with Saruman, weā€™re not given the opportunity to watch Lothrandir ā€˜resistā€™ in the same fashion the player character did. We donā€™t need to. Saruman has bigger and better things to worry about- killing a prince, wiping out a nation- than one Ranger who heā€™s just going to order well-flayed again. By setting himself up as the punching bag, Lothrandir has managed to fly beneath Sarumanā€™s priority threshold. Heā€™s been relegated to the responsibility of Gun Ain, and still with somewhat protected status because they havenā€™t wormed anything useful out of him yet.
All of these moves have culminated to an impasse. Saruman is not winning points in the game like he expected. One ā€˜meathead Rangerā€™ has managed to resist all the torments of Isengard, and heā€™s gained nothing from this. The other prisoner escaped, word had doubtless reached him that the Tur Morva Thirty-Odd are free and raring to be a thorn in his side again. He has no external leverage to apply on Lothrandir and itā€™s become increasingly obvious that our Ranger friend is not engaging like the player did. But still, Saruman has his pride. Itā€™s his downfall in the end, and itā€™s his downfall in his fight against the one Ranger whoā€™s already beating him. Lothrandir canā€™t be killed outright because Saruman hasnā€™t won yet. And with that guarantee of protection, Lothrandir can coast all the way to the conquest of Isengard.Ā 
He can keep playing the game and stalling for time. Itā€™s morbid, but what better way to waste someoneā€™s time and energy than convincing them slow, drawn-out torture is the way to go? A little extreme, Lothrandir, but itā€™s still his game to lose. He wastes Sarumanā€™s time. If he is eventually rescued, total victory. If heā€™s killed in the end, he definitely didnā€™t give the wizard the satisfaction, so a less resounding victory but one in the win column nonetheless.Ā 
With a little help from our usually Ranger-cidal devs, Lothrandir reprograms Sarumanā€™s game of chess to a boxing match. He takes out all his disadvantages, gets Isengard to attack from a point of... if not weakness then at least neutral ability, and then devotes his every waking breath to violent disobedience.
Sure, you could have taken any of the Grey Company with you to Isengard. Lheu Brenin could have swapped out for Braigar or Amlan or Mithrendan or Culang- but only one of these guys has the brute strength, commitment, and sheer audacity to pull it off.Ā 
You take Lothrandir to Orthanc. Thereā€™s a different prisoner of Nan Curunir when he leaves.

Februaryā€™s Featured Game: Returning Nightmares
DEVELOPER(S):Ā Saturn ENGINE: RPGMaker 2003 GENRE: YNFG, Exploration, Adventure WARNINGS: Blood, Gore, Swearing, Suicide SUMMARY: Returning Nightmares is an exploration adventure-horror game being developed in RPG Maker 2003, inspired by Yume Nikki and it's multiple fan-made homages (but with dialogue & easier to navigate maps). You play as Akira, a young man locked up in his own bedroom, exploring his dreams to remember the events that lead him to where he is now. But some things are better left aloneā€¦

Do you have any advice for upcoming devs? *Saturn: Learning how to make a game is like learning how to read or how to do math: you won't be able to read To Kill a Mockingbird right away, nor will you be doing advanced algebra. It took a lot of time for you to be able to do either. Give yourself a break when you learn how to make a game as well: you won't learn how to make a big one in a month! Feel free to screw up. Someone says "Don't do that, it'll be too big"? Do it anyway: you'll either fail and learn a lesson, or you'll succeed and then look back and say, "Oh crap, I could of done that better now that I learned everything new." Either way, you got more practice to make another game, but better. "But I screwed up...." - see paragraph 1 on this question for the answer to that. Cut yourself some slack and remember you're doing this because you want to enjoy making a game! I found the best way I learned is by looking into other games (thanks Bleet & Jojogape for being cool with people looking at their games). I suggest finding the best way you learn as well, whether it's written tutorials, asking people, looking at other people's games, video tutorials, or just messing with the engine yourself. Lastly, I found the best way to take pressure off myself when making a game (as someone who loves perfection) was to make a few goofy joke games first. If they were bad, that was fine: they were supposed to be funny bad! It's like releasing steam by making MS Paint drawings, it makes you laugh and feel less nervous.

Vampire Game Reviews Part 1
Tumblr media
This Halloween I sat down and played a bunch of vampire themed games and decided to review them. First up, Vampire Legends: The True Story of Kisilova, Dracula: Origin and Vampire the Masquerade: Bloodlines. I might get around to Vampire the Masquerade: Redemption and Dracula: Love Kills in a later post.
I use my own 5-scale gradation in this:
0: Either I couldnā€™t force myself to finish it, or I was more relieved it was over than anything else. 1: I had no fun, but there might have been something fun in thereā€¦ maybeā€¦? 2: More bad than good. 3: About evenly good and bad. I actually start having more fun than not. 4: A solid entertainment piece. Has itā€™s blemishes, but despite that I like it. 5: Almost perfect (perfection is a myth). I had lots of fun and am satisfied.
(Semi-minor spoilers below. Unless youā€™ve gone quite far into the games, you likely wont suss out whatā€™s happening until itā€™s happening.)
Tumblr media
Vampire Legends: The True Story of Kisilova: Youā€™re an investigator for the Hapsburg Empire going to the small town of Kisilova, recently beset by a killer leaving bloodless victims behind them. Rumors of vampires abound. After a series of mishaps the rumors do not feel so farfetched. Especially not when a mysterious, young woman enters the picture.
Tumblr media
(Left: The Beginning of the Adventure with our buddy and hint machine. Right: The first of many, many hidden objects screens in this game.)
Okay, it is a point-and-click visual novel adventure thing thatā€™s really short (less than 5 hours, and I think I left the game ā€” and the clock ā€” running for a while at some point), and also cheap. It was enjoyable enough, the music was forgettable but good enough, the graphics nice and atmospheric enough and the story was short and serviceable. The problems mainly came through the game-play; this game relied faaar too heavily on hidden object minigames, and those were unskippable, while all others were skippable after a short while. Fortunately, your partner can give hints to speed things along. As for my final decision in the winter-themed bonus chapter? Well, it was Halloween so I thought ā€œwhy not?ā€ and that was that for Europe. I always try to pick the most supernatural decision whenever I can lol (see Squirrel Elves in the Witcher franchise, or picking spell-sneaking classes in the Elder Scrolls).
My biggest problem with this game, however, is that I need to resize the resolution on my ultrawide monitor to play it without horizontal stretching distorting the art. The Options menu is seriously lacking in Options (actually, that whole menu is a mess that looks more at home in a Free-to-Play mobile game).
All in all, I generally liked it and its short nature meant that except for the hidden objects minigame, most of it didnā€™t outstay its welcome and it was really cheap (less than 4ā‚¬ when I bought it, which is about the right price IMO. I think regular price is something like 9.99ā‚¬?) so worth it. 3/5.
Tumblr media
Dracula: Origin: You are Van Helsing. Yeah. That guy. And you have a missing friend, Harker, who had something to do with Dracula, and you have a pretty friend named Mina who ends up targeted by Dracula and now you must rush across the Old World to save her from a curse.
Tumblr media
(Left: Yup, same dev as the Sherlock Holmes games. Middle: Vampires donā€™t like garlic breath. Right: Dammit Mina, I gave you ONE job. One. Job. All of this slow walking could have been avoided!)
Ah. Frogware. I generally like their Sherlock Holmes games, but this gameā€¦ It felt more like a waste of my time. Oh, Iā€™m sure there is a good game in there that isnā€™t a waste of time. Unfortunately, it is hidden behind the biggest time-sinks in the game: Van Helsing walks at half the speed of a normal person at all times and speaks really slowly, in conversations that has no branches, yet they will periodically be interrupted so that you can click on the next topic in the list (that wont reveal the next topic until youā€™ve listened to the topic listed before it). Thereā€™s this scene during a cave in when he says something like ā€œquickly, we must make haste to escape!ā€ and then you click on the exit and he waaaaaaaaalks slooooooooooooowlyyyyyy through it. It certainly doesnā€™t help that he must cross the entire span of the screen and backtrack locations many times andā€¦ AGH! RUN YOU FOOL!!
And, well, Frogware adventure game with its strange clues and non-clues and objects. Thereā€™s this bit in the first outdoor area when you have to capture some flies. Now, if you have followed the story logically, you will have a jar and a lid in your inventory. Easy, peasy, just click the flies with the jar, right? Nope. You must find a mourning veil hidden in the cemetery (that is large and that Van Helsing waaaaalks sloooooowlyyyyy through), use it on the flies and then combine the fly-ridden veil with the jar to get a jar of flies (I wont say what for because of spoilers, but, well, I donā€™t recommend eating during the Cemetery/Mansion part of the story if you have a phobia against bugs). There are also several objects that are basically five pixels on the screen because of the angle weā€™re viewing them at that we must find to pick up, and on the whole, I had more frustrations than fun with this story. Like, thereā€™s even this puzzle minigame with a picture of Minos, the Labyrinth and the Minotaur and you find thread/string in the same house and wouldnā€™t you know it! The thread/string has nothing to do with the minigame and the minigame has nothing to do with the legend of the Minotaur!
On top of that, well, lets just say that the Egyptian section has quite a bit of stereotyping (think Victorian stereotypes of Egypt and its people in a modern game. Also, potential racism against white people must be prevented at all costs, including lying to a bereaved family), and when we run into our first, unliving female vampire she of course wears a top made of strips of cloth and a sheer skirt (youā€™d think a rich vampireā€™s favorite mistress would own a nice dress at least, but nope), and every woman (including dead of non-vampiric variety) have their beauty commented upon (and, of course, a young, pretty girlā€™s defilement/death is a tragedy, which is why it is so important to include that she was pretty).
And, well, this game markets itself heavily with Dracula at the forefront, not Van Helsing, yet while Dracula is the main antagonist, he only has a few, brief scenes, which were disappointing. All in all it was a 1/5.
Tumblr media
Vampire the Masquerade: Bloodlines: You are a fledgling of one of the Camarilla clans, recently thrust into the secret world hidden by darkness, and more specifically into one of the most fucked cities of the World of Darkness. After your illicit embrace into the undead by your executed sire, the Prince of the City has graciously offered to adopt you, provided you prove yourself worthy to the exacting clan of rulers. Except the princeā€™s domain is built on quicksand, and this is Los Angeles; the birthplace of the modern Anarchs, and one of the domains of the Kindred of the East, on top of the eternal, political dance all Kindred must dance, and you, baby vampire as you are, have no allies and no clue as how to proceed except to survive.
Tumblr media
(Left: Told ya Velvet is a mascot in this game. Middle: Did you know that Mercurio was meant to handle the Voerman sisters and we wouldnā€™t have to go through sewers and a haunted hotel if he did his job? Right: Apparently the Chinese are masters of Japanese swords and the Ventrue need no neckbones...)
Hereā€™s the thing about VtM:B: It is a very enjoyable game and definitely the definite vampire game out there. It also has no story for your character. ā€œWhat about the Ankaran Sarcophagus?ā€, well, your character participates, but it does nothing to answer the questions we are immediately confronted with in the opening of the game: Why would our unknown sire, an upstanding member of Kindred society, break one of the Traditions (pretty much laws set in stone for all Kindred over the entire world) to embrace us? Why would the prince, whose sole job is to uphold the Traditions, then break one of the Traditions and allow the ill-begotten progeny live?
Except for the opening of the game, we never hear from our sire again, nor the questions raised during the opening. And that makes our player character a bit superfluous when any random neonate could serve just as well.
So if not story-telling, what does VtM:B do that makes people sing its praises? In short? Characters and the World. It is incredibly atmospheric and while characters donā€™t develop (vampires are static by nature in this world, and most characters in the game are entrenched in their places and wont be shaken by some random baby vampire showing up), they are all very distinct and written in different tones. However, if youā€™re not role-playing as an ignorant fledgling, but meta-playing with some Vampire the Masquerade lore known, you will feel extremely railroaded (if your character had any inkling of who Smiling Jack is in the World of Darkness, they would never believe his coarse but kind uncle-figure thing heā€™s got going on. Because even before a certain hugely Biblical spoiler got involved, Jack was an imposer, liar, manipulator and mass-murderer who has sired many, many thin-blooded vampires and abandoned them to their fates. Thereā€™s a reason why only ignorant neonates like Ninesā€™ gang admires and likes him. What I just said is not a spoiler for the game, btw, because it never comes up because your character is an ignorant fledgling being manipulated and deceived by literally everyone. Maybe Velvet and Bertram donā€™t, but Velvet might seem so sweet when she convinces you to be her knight because of Presence and acting, and Bertram is a Nossie and they have major secrets within secrets).
And while it is easy to sink into the world of the game and roleplay, thus mitigating the railroading feeling above. This game was clearly written with an audience of White Male Teens in mind. We have Velvet (of the fashion-conscious Toreador clan) show up at the princeā€™s court in Elysium in only a lacy basque, g-string and thigh high fishnets, tall heels and not as much as a peignoir thrown on top. Yeah, she attends an important society function in her fetish underwear. Then we have the explicit sex life of game cover-girl Jeanette (yeah, the one dressed like a dilapidated school girl), and those two are THE female mascots of the game.
The less said about the Orientalism and the Kindred of the East the better, but that segues into how around the time you reach Chinatown, the game starts losing its luster and strengths. Okay, so if youā€™re sensitive to that kinda thing, you might notice it a little bit in Hollywood, but by the time Chinatown rolls around, you might notice how it is less immersive and how it starts to feel more and more gamey (specifically, Action gamey), and you get less options that isnā€™t some variant of ā€œkill itā€.
On top of that the game has technical issues if you do not use the fan-made patch (I always use Patch Plus, which restores cut content and quests, as well as ReShade for better anti-aliasing and sharpness), and it still has a few cropping up from time to time. At least it works perfectly well in ultrawide resolutions?
Still it has that charm, and despite its flaws and how I can think of a dozen complaints at the drop of a dime, I still love playing it. So itā€™s a 4/5 from me.

I think I pinned down a major element in the difference between Bioshock 1 and 2ā€²s writing
Character Motivation
NOTE: Contains spoilersĀ for and criticismĀ of Bioshock 1, possibly minor spoilers for Bioshock 2. If BS1 is your favorite game you may want to give this a miss.
---
(this turned into a list of BS1 grievances, ctrl+F ā€œthe twistā€ or ā€œBS2ā€³ if you want to jump to the relevant point)
Iā€™ve mentioned it before in my Bioshock run, but Bioshock 1 has some glaringly obvious writing issues.Ā 
Most notable to me were the first Plasmid injection - because as far as I can tell, and I spent some time trying to trigger a radio call, there is absolutely reason given for you to use it. As a Person Playing A Video Game, Iā€™m going,Ā ā€œoh, hereā€™s a locked door and a shiny item. If I grab the item it will probably (help me) open the doorā€. The player character has no such motivation. Thatā€™s okay, video games can be like that.
Less so how the Plasmid-getting actually works. IDK about anyone else, but I could notĀ see the syringe before picking it up. Additionally, despite the pieces of advertisment about, there arenā€™t actually any explanations about what a Plasmid isĀ or actually does. The goofy period-appropriate ad design doesnā€™t tell me, a player just starting this game, that not only am I actually gonna get in-universe superpowers but also a torturous DNA-modification cutscene.
So it was extremelyĀ surprising to press E to pick up this round glowing thing and have the player character immediately jam a horse needle into his arm with no apparent impetus.
Point 2 is in Arcadia. Searching boxes and bodies here yields crafting supplies. Again, as A Person Playing A Video Game, I know whatā€™s happening. But the player character has no reason to start picking up crafting goods at this time. Itā€™s around 5-15 minutes of gameplay after you start picking them up that you actually find a place for them, and 10-ish minutes after that for your Voice Over Buddy to mention them.
Frankly, a large part of my problem with these bits is that the devs have a tool right thereĀ to avoid them; Atlas is telling you all sorts of things, it would be simple to have him say,Ā ā€œHey, this is gonna hurt like a somebitch, but I need you to grab that shiny thing in the dispenser and inject it into your body to open this door.ā€ He DOES tell you about crafting, just way too late - and later in the game they absolutely have items show up on already-searched containers after triggering a plot flag, so this one is also p inexcusable.
In fact, from my point of view, the devs improve at making video games as they made the game. Part 1 had a lot of other minor issues - rooms where the surprise mob surprised you by having the room fill with smoke or fog as soon as you hit a plot trigger; the entire medical wing section felt more like a boring, grind-y pseudo-tutorial than an actual good plot segment; supposedly-Plasmid-abusing not-monsters failing to use any of the superpowers your character obtained seemingly effortlessly.
Later in the game, there is no fog- or smoke-rooms (at least not on Easy difficulty), but they combine two points by having Houdini Splicers - who use Plasmid powers that include, aside from pure offense, smoke-creation and teleportation, in a way the player can still track. Itā€™s much, much more elegant than the previous areas.Ā 
In a number of small other ways, particularly the writing, the game just becomes smoother the further into it you get (not in a way that feels intentional). Unfortunately, the first half of the game feels very much like they made the game, then wrote it, then built the second half around what they wrote.
One thing is The Twist. While it does explain some things - it makes an amount of sense for your character to know things about how Rapture and Plasmids work - it makes the entire fabrication of Atlas.... almost pointless, from the PCā€™s point of view. While you do start shaking off some indoctrination by the end, Fontaine can lead you around pretty effortlessly. He doesnā€™t needĀ to win over your love or sympathy. I mean, yeah, heā€™s playing dead (I guess Ryan could hear him and realize who it is?) and Atlas is an established front, but it just doesnā€™t really hold up to close inspection. The entire point of Atlas is to foolĀ the Player, at the cost of plot integrity.
After The Twist, youā€™re still dancing to someone elseā€™s tune, but someone with whom I think the Player is much more sympathetic to. The wholeĀ ā€˜a man chooses, a slave obeysā€™ doesnā€™t really read as much of a choice-based plot if the vast majority of the plotline, minus some ending details, is in the hands of people other than the Player/Player Character.Ā 
My motivationĀ in BS1 differs from the characterā€™s, because even at the end I donā€™t knowĀ my characterā€™s motivation. And while blank-slate PCs and inscrutable PCs can work, Iā€™m not entirely sure 2k was ever consciously going for that. If they were, I shouldnā€™t have to wonder.
---
The motivation in BS2 is much clearer, imo. I kind of wonder if the reason the Big Daddy segment in BS1 was so fun is because it came with a complete clarity of purpose - you want to protect the Little Sister.
The PC motivation in BS2, thus far, is extremely clear: Find yourĀ Little Sister. She contacts you throughout the game, clearly in need of help, and you want to help her, find her, reconnect with her. Unless they pull another twist at some point (and they better have the best motherfucking writer in the universe on board for it tbh), I know exactly what my character wants, and I agree with it.
This also makes the voice-over and helper characters fit into the plot better - Tennenbaum remains within established personality parameters. Sinclair is looking to turn a profit, and bringing down Lamb might help that goal - I donā€™t trust his character, but I understand that we need him to accomplish our clearly defined personal goal. Weā€™ll tolerate him for as long as he helps us, and if he turns on us, I personally have no problem killing him - and I donā€™t think Delta would, either.
BS2 still has some writing issues, but both the map and the overarching plot read much, much clearer to me.

Animated bloody tearsĀ 
Through some unforeseen miracle of black magic, we now have a Castlevania animated series on Netflix. It debuted three days ago, and despite getting less promotion than I wouldā€™ve liked, Castlevania is finally once again getting some much-deserved mainstream attention in this day and age.Ā 
Iā€™m the biggest Castlevania nerd I know. I designed a whole series of Hero Forge minis based off of the Belmonts and their buddies and I even credit the franchise withĀ helping me get over my childhood fear of vampires. So even though I barely watch new TV shows, as a former kid who used to visitĀ Mr. Pā€™s Castlevania Realm and The Castlevania Dungeon on a daily basis, I had to check this out. And happily enough, I thought it was great. Most of all, Iā€™m astounded that this finally got made at all, because the original script, by comic book dude Warren Ellis (he's written some good Iron Man stuff) is a relicĀ that was originally supposed to be for a live-action film and got stuck in development hell ten years ago. Just look at this Bleeding Cool article revealing one of Ellisā€™ production blogs from 2007, complete with ancient concept art.Ā 
Usually scripts are trapped in dev hell for a reason, and I can recall reading a leaked version of the ā€œgoat fuckingā€ dialogue referenced in that Bleeding Cool piece back when I was in high school. The whole thing made me think, ā€œJeez, itā€™s probably for the best that Castlevania never becomes a movie.ā€ But wouldnā€™t ya know, over a decade later, they decided to subvert my predictions by resistingĀ the urge to churn out another crappy video game film adaptation. Instead, they made a cartoon, and will wonders never cease - the goat fucking bit is still there, right at the end of episode one, and itā€™s actually funny.
So yeah, Castlevania the series ended up exceeding my expectations, largely due to a few smart choices. First of all, the animation, while occasionally stiff (which is par the course for most digital animation these days), reminds me of 1980s anime, and considering that the 1985 Vampire Hunter D movie was an inspiration for the entire Castlevania series, I feel like weā€™ve gone full circle. Secondly, the show retells the plot of Castlevania III: Draculaā€™s Curse, which had a stunning four playable characters and a tonĀ of storytelling potential that couldnā€™t be fully communicated due to theĀ limitations of the NES. This meant that Warren Ellis had some room for creativity in retelling the tale of Trevor Belmont, and he does a fine job of making the dude into a sarcastic, weary undead-killing exile. But Ellis and the showā€™s other creators were also smart enough to know that Symphony of the Night is everyoneā€™s favorite Castlevania, and so weā€™ve got some lore cherry-picked from there as well. This includes backstory on Lisa, one of the few human women that Draculaā€™s loved, as well as characterization for fan-favorite dhampir son Alucard, who looks just like his Symphony design, minus the cape.Ā  Speaking of Alucardā€™s design, the series really does a nice job of pulling the fanservice card with these little touches that make it seem like the folks in charge were actual Castlevania fans, which often isnā€™t the case with video game adaptations. It begins with Dracula literally crying bloody tears in the first episode (God, I loved that), goes on to Trevorā€™s usage of his in-game arsenal of whip, dagger, axe and holy water, and ends with a fight between two characters that I wonā€™t spoil but is rad, because itā€™s exactly what anyone who played Castlevania III or Symphony of the Night mightā€™ve imagined.Ā 
Of course, not everythingā€™s perfect, and the biggest issue I have is that the wholeĀ ā€œseasonā€ is only four episodes. That ainā€™t a season, thatā€™s a teaser, and when thinking back to the fact that Warren Ellisā€™ original script was for a feature-length film, its obvious that this was made as one big movie and then chopped into four bite-sized bits, probably because the bastards at Netflix (who cancelled season 2 of The Get Down, argh) didnā€™t wanna commit. But hey, theyā€™ve since ordered eight new episodes, and hopefully in the next batch weā€™ll see more varied monster designs. (Sadly, if that Bleeding Cool article is any indication, it seems like we wonā€™t see Grant DaNasty, the other playable character of Castlevania III. Seems like heā€™s going to remain absent in lieu of more focus on Sypha Belnades and Alucard, which is understandable but still kinda sucks.)Ā 
Finally, the showā€™s music is forgettable as hell, which is a shame when Castlevania is a series known for its superb tunes. Castlevania III in particular had an astounding playlist, especially in the Japanese version, which utilized a special sound chip to create extra channels and manifest some truly badass chiptune tracks. Iā€™m not expecting a major musical change in season two, but hey...Iā€™d love to hear at least someĀ hint ofĀ ā€œVampire Killerā€ in the soundtrack. These are minor complaints in the grand scheme of things, though. For now, Iā€™m just happy that we have a solid adaptation of Castlevania that takes the source material seriously, and Iā€™m looking forward to watching more.
